Study On The Soil And Water Conservation Function Of Microbiotic Soil Crusts On Loess Area Of Northern Shaanxi Province

For further study on the soil and water conservation function of microbiotic soil crusts in Loess areas,based on a large number of collecting date from investigation in WU-Qi,made anti-scouring experiments of microbiotic soil crusts,and analysed microbiotic soil crusts physical and chemical properties and distribution on Loess area of northern Shaanxi province.It gives an important reference value for the soil erosion controlling in Loess Area.The major conclusions are as follows:Analysis on physicochemical characteristics of the microbiotic soil crusts indicated different types of microbiotic soil crusts had nutrients enrichment,except the potassium content.Cu,Cr and Ca was the important factor to the distribution of microbiotic soil crusts.Microbiotic soil crusts can reduce the soil pH value.The average thickness of microbiotic soil crusts can reach 3.67 mm,the coverage of crusts was not higher than 30%;microbiotic soil crusts composed of fine sand particles(0.05-0.01mm) and coarse silt(0.25-0.05mm).Microbiotic soil crusts had changed the soil sand,silt and clay content,and K value,which can impact the soil anti-erosion ability.The factors influencing the distribution of microbiotic soil crusts indicated the coverage of microbiotic soil crusts on north-facing slope and semi-north-facing slope was larger than on south-facing slope and semi-south-facing slope;larger on gully-slope than ridge-slope than the top of slope;the microbiotic soil crusts cover decreased as the gradient increasing,and while it increased later. Microbiotic soil crust cover was increasing with vegetation cover and decreasing during 50%~60% vegetation cover.The coverage of microbiotic soil crusts was shown as to:the herb-based one>the tree-based one>the tree-based one.Microbiotic soil crusts cover and littler cover on south-facing slope and semi-south-facing slope was inhibiting,but the relation of that on north-facing slope and semi-north-facing slope was stimulating.The overage of microbiotic soil crustss on slopes with a low disturbance degree is larger than that with a high one.Anti-scourability experiment of microbiotic soil crusts indicated the moss content in microbiotic soil crusts was an important anti-scourability factor and had a negative correlation with sediment concentration,while a positive correlation with the time of microbiotic soil crusts collapsing.During the process of scouring,sediment concentration increased with scouring time,and decreased after microbiotic soil crusts collapsed.Anti-scourability had quadratic relationship with scouring time.As the microbiotic soil crusts collapsed with time,anti-scourability decreased.The coverage of microbiotic soil crusts had a negative correlation with sediment concentration,i.e.the higher the coverage was,the lower the soil erosion was.Slope had a positive correlation with sediment concentration.The erosion rate for soil without crusts covering was 35 times of that with a fully covered surface.
